CLINTON — Raymond J. “Nook” Kelly, 89, of Clinton, died Thursday, February 21, 2008, at Mercy Medical Center, North Campus, Clinton.Funeral services will be 10:00 a.m. Monday, February 25, 2008, at First United Methodist Church with Pastor Bobb Barrick officiating. Burial will be in Springdale Cemetery with military honors being conducted by Clinton AMVETS Post 28. Serving as pallbearers will be Samuel Kelly, Daniel Kelly, Greg Kelly, Brandon Kooi, Scott Kelly and Tim Shinbori. Honorary pallbearers will be Devin Kelly, Dennie Holverson, and Dick Kelly. Visitation will be Sunday from 2:00-5:00 p.m. at the Clinton Chapel Snell-Zornig Funeral Home and Crematory.Raymond James Kelly was born on November 1, 1918, in Grand Mound, Iowa, the son of Raymond and Helen (Pearse) Kelly. He married Nancy Ruth Bowers on May 31, 1943, in Las Vegas, Nevada; she died January 27, 2008.Raymond was a graduate of Grand Mound High School. He was a veteran of World War II, serving in the United States Army as a master sergeant and post office supervisor.Raymond worked in the finishing department at DuPont for thirty years until retiring in 1979. He enjoyed dancing, fishing, played the saxophone and was the lead singer in the Gus Kelly Swing Band. Raymond is survived by two sons, Stephen (Cindy) Kelly of Camanche and David (Kathy) Kelly of Clinton; six grandchildren, Erin (Brandon) Kooi, Greg (Nadene) Kelly, Daniel (Esmé) Kelly, Nancy Kelly, Samuel Kelly and Devin Kelly; six great-grandchildren, Maddison, Logan and Kennedy Kooi, Mackenzie, Kaelan and David Kelly; one brother, Larry (Jo) Kelly of DeWitt; one sister-in-law, Irene Kelly of Naples, Florida; as well as several nieces and nephews. Raymond was preceded in death by his wife, Nancy, his parents, and one brother, Robert.The family requests that memorials be made to Mercy Dialysis Unit.Online condolences can be made to the family by visiting his obituary at www.snellzornig.com.Death date: Feb. 21, 2008
